FTO, type 2 diabetes, and weight gain throughout adult life: a meta-analysis of 41,504 subjects from the Scandinavian HUNT, MDC, and MPP studies.
Diabetes - 1 May 2011
Hertel Jens K, Johansson Stefan, Sonestedt Emily, Jonsson Anna, Lie Rolv T, Platou Carl G P, Nilsson Peter M, Rukh Gull, Midthjell Kristian, Hveem Kristian, Melander Olle, Groop Leif, Lyssenko Valeriya, Molven Anders, Orho-Melander Marju, Njølstad Pål R
Abstract excerpt
OBJECTIVE: FTO is the most important polygene identified for obesity. We aimed to investigate whether a variant in FTO affects type 2 diabetes risk entirely through its effect on BMI and how FTO influences BMI across adult life span. RESEARCH DESIGN AND METHODS: Through regression models, we assessed the relationship between the FTO single nucleotide polymorphisms rs9939609, type 2 diabetes, and BMI across life...
